"""
Simple data loader for OpenHands Index leaderboard.
Loads JSONL files from local directory or GitHub repository.
Uses pydantic models from openhands-index-results for validation.
"""
import os
import sys
import logging
import pandas as pd
import json
from pathlib import Path
from typing import Optional
logger = logging.getLogger(__name__)
# Pydantic models will be imported after setup_data adds them to path
_schema_models_loaded = False
Metadata = None
ScoreEntry = None
def _ensure_schema_models():
"""Lazily import pydantic schema models from openhands-index-results."""
global _schema_models_loaded, Metadata, ScoreEntry
if _schema_models_loaded:
return _schema_models_loaded
try:
# Try importing from the cloned repo's scripts directory
from validate_schema import Metadata as _Metadata, ScoreEntry as _ScoreEntry
Metadata = _Metadata
ScoreEntry = _ScoreEntry
_schema_models_loaded = True
logger.info("Successfully loaded pydantic schema models from openhands-index-results")
except ImportError as e:
logger.warning(f"Could not import pydantic schema models: {e}")
logger.warning("Data will be loaded without schema validation")
_schema_models_loaded = False
return _schema_models_loaded
def load_and_validate_agent_data(agent_dir: Path) -> tuple[Optional[dict], Optional[list], list[str]]:
"""
Load and validate agent data using pydantic models if available.
Returns:
Tuple of (metadata_dict, scores_list, validation_errors)
"""
errors = []
metadata_file = agent_dir / "metadata.json"
scores_file = agent_dir / "scores.json"
if not metadata_file.exists() or not scores_file.exists():
return None, None, [f"Missing metadata.json or scores.json in {agent_dir}"]
# Load raw JSON
with open(metadata_file) as f:
metadata_raw = json.load(f)
with open(scores_file) as f:
scores_raw = json.load(f)
# Validate with pydantic if available
if _ensure_schema_models() and Metadata and ScoreEntry:
try:
validated_metadata = Metadata(**metadata_raw)
# Use mode='json' to serialize enums as strings
metadata_dict = validated_metadata.model_dump(mode='json')
except Exception as e:
errors.append(f"Metadata validation error in {agent_dir.name}: {e}")
metadata_dict = metadata_raw # Fall back to raw data
validated_scores = []
for i, score in enumerate(scores_raw):
try:
validated_score = ScoreEntry(**score)
# Use mode='json' to serialize enums as strings
validated_dict = validated_score.model_dump(mode='json')
# Preserve any extra fields from raw data (like full_archive)
for key, value in score.items():
if key not in validated_dict:
validated_dict[key] = value
validated_scores.append(validated_dict)
except Exception as e:
errors.append(f"Score entry {i} validation error in {agent_dir.name}: {e}")
validated_scores.append(score) # Fall back to raw data
scores_list = validated_scores
else:
# No validation, use raw data
metadata_dict = metadata_raw
scores_list = scores_raw
return metadata_dict, scores_list, errors
class SimpleLeaderboardViewer:
"""Simple replacement for agent-eval's LeaderboardViewer."""
AGENT_FILTER_OPENHANDS = "openhands"
AGENT_FILTER_ALTERNATIVE = "alternative"
def __init__(
self,
data_dir: str,
config: str,
split: str,
agent_filter: str = AGENT_FILTER_OPENHANDS,
):
"""
Args:
data_dir: Path to data directory
config: Config name (e.g., "1.0.0-dev1")
split: Split name (e.g., "validation" or "test")
agent_filter: Which submissions to include.
``"openhands"`` (default) loads only the default OpenHands
agent runs from ``results/{model}/`` — the canonical
leaderboard. ``"alternative"`` loads only third-party
harnesses (Claude Code / Codex / Gemini CLI / OpenHands
Sub-agents) from ``alternative_agents/{type}/{model}/``,
which power the standalone Alternative Agents page.
The two are kept on separate pages because their
cost/runtime numbers aren't apples-to-apples and mixing
them in one ranking would be misleading.
"""
if agent_filter not in (self.AGENT_FILTER_OPENHANDS, self.AGENT_FILTER_ALTERNATIVE):
raise ValueError(
f"agent_filter must be one of "
f"{{{self.AGENT_FILTER_OPENHANDS!r}, {self.AGENT_FILTER_ALTERNATIVE!r}}}, "
f"got {agent_filter!r}"
)
self.data_dir = Path(data_dir)
self.config = config
self.split = split
self.agent_filter = agent_filter
self.config_path = self.data_dir / config
# Benchmark to category mappings (single source of truth)
self.benchmark_to_categories = {
'swe-bench': ['Issue Resolution'],
'swe-bench-multimodal': ['Frontend'],
'commit0': ['Greenfield'],
'swt-bench': ['Testing'],
'gaia': ['Information Gathering'],
}
# Build tag map (category -> benchmarks)
self.tag_map = {}
for benchmark, categories in self.benchmark_to_categories.items():
for category in categories:
if category not in self.tag_map:
self.tag_map[category] = []
if benchmark not in self.tag_map[category]:
self.tag_map[category].append(benchmark)
# Default agent_name when metadata.json doesn't carry one. Matches the
# default-agent value used by push_to_index_from_archive.py so legacy
# entries (which omit the field) still group cleanly with new entries.
DEFAULT_AGENT_NAME = "OpenHands"
def _records_from_agent_dir(self, agent_dir: Path, default_agent_name: str | None = None) -> tuple[list[dict], list[str]]:
"""Build per-benchmark records from a single agent directory.
Shared by ``_load_from_agent_dirs`` (default OpenHands results) and
``_load_from_alternative_agents_dirs`` (acp-claude / acp-codex / etc.).
Returns ``(records, validation_errors)``. Returns an empty list of
records when the directory has no scores or is hidden from the
leaderboard.
"""
records: list[dict] = []
metadata, scores, errors = load_and_validate_agent_data(agent_dir)
if metadata is None or scores is None:
return records, errors
if metadata.get('hide_from_leaderboard', False):
logger.info(f"Skipping {agent_dir.name}: hide_from_leaderboard is True")
return records, errors
# Resolve the agent display name. Prefer the value stamped into
# metadata.json by push-to-index; fall back to the directory's
# default (e.g. "Claude Code" for acp-claude/) and finally to
# "OpenHands" for legacy results/ entries that predate the field.
agent_name = (
metadata.get('agent_name')
or default_agent_name
or self.DEFAULT_AGENT_NAME
)
for score_entry in scores:
record = {
'agent_name': agent_name,
'agent_version': metadata.get('agent_version', 'Unknown'),
'llm_base': metadata.get('model', 'unknown'),
'openness': metadata.get('openness', 'unknown'),
'submission_time': score_entry.get('submission_time', metadata.get('submission_time', '')),
'release_date': metadata.get('release_date', ''),
'parameter_count_b': metadata.get('parameter_count_b'),
'active_parameter_count_b': metadata.get('active_parameter_count_b'),
'score': score_entry.get('score'),
'metric': score_entry.get('metric', 'unknown'),
'cost_per_instance': score_entry.get('cost_per_instance'),
'average_runtime': score_entry.get('average_runtime'),
'tags': [score_entry.get('benchmark')],
'full_archive': score_entry.get('full_archive', ''),
'eval_visualization_page': score_entry.get('eval_visualization_page', ''),
}
records.append(record)
return records, errors
def _load_from_agent_dirs(self):
"""Load agent records based on ``self.agent_filter``.
- ``"openhands"`` (default): only ``{config}/results/{model}/``,
which is the canonical OpenHands leaderboard. The Home page and
the per-category subpages use this.
- ``"alternative"``: only
``{config}/alternative_agents/{type}/{model}/`` (acp-claude,
acp-codex, acp-gemini, openhands_subagents, ...). The dedicated
Alternative Agents page uses this.
Returns ``None`` if no records were found (which makes the caller
render an empty-state placeholder).
"""
all_records = []
all_validation_errors = []
if self.agent_filter == self.AGENT_FILTER_OPENHANDS:
# Default OpenHands agent results
results_dir = self.config_path / "results"
if results_dir.exists():
for agent_dir in results_dir.iterdir():
if not agent_dir.is_dir():
continue
records, errors = self._records_from_agent_dir(agent_dir)
all_records.extend(records)
all_validation_errors.extend(errors)
else:
# Alternative agents (one subdirectory per agent_type, then per model)
# Default agent_name per agent_type matches the AGENT_NAME_BY_TYPE
# map in OpenHands/evaluation push_to_index_from_archive.py — keeping
# it in sync ensures rows are labelled the same way the index repo
# records them.
agent_type_default_name = {
'acp-claude': 'Claude Code',
'acp-codex': 'Codex',
'acp-gemini': 'Gemini CLI',
'openhands_subagents': 'OpenHands Sub-agents',
}
alt_dir = self.config_path / "alternative_agents"
if alt_dir.exists():
for type_dir in alt_dir.iterdir():
if not type_dir.is_dir():
continue
default_name = agent_type_default_name.get(type_dir.name)
for agent_dir in type_dir.iterdir():
if not agent_dir.is_dir():
continue
records, errors = self._records_from_agent_dir(
agent_dir, default_agent_name=default_name
)
all_records.extend(records)
all_validation_errors.extend(errors)
# Log validation errors if any
if all_validation_errors:
logger.warning(f"Schema validation errors ({len(all_validation_errors)} total):")
for error in all_validation_errors[:5]: # Show first 5
logger.warning(f" - {error}")
if len(all_validation_errors) > 5:
logger.warning(f" ... and {len(all_validation_errors) - 5} more")
if not all_records:
return None # Caller will render empty-state placeholder
return pd.DataFrame(all_records)
